Stop At: The Alhambra, Calle Real de la Alhambra, s/n Palacio de Carlos V, 18009 Granada Spain
The Alhambra is a palace and fortress complex. It was constructed as a small fortress in AD 889 on the remains of Roman fortifications, and then largely ignored until its ruins were renovated and rebuilt in the mid-13th century by the Nasrid emir Mohammed ben Al-Ahmar of the Emirate of Granada, who built its current palace and walls.
Duration: 2 hours
Stop At: Generalife Realejo-San Matias, 18009 Granada Spain
Is a villa that dates from the beginning of the 14th century and was used as a summer Palace by the Nasrid rulers of the Emirate of Granada in Al-Andalus
